Jay Pipes wrote: > I don't necessarily think any of us were discussing optimization of the > code base, but good coding practices to ensure we think about optimal > performance while we do refactoring and addition of new features. I > totally agree with you about premature optimization. But I also think > it is important for the gurus among us (not me... :) ) to share their > knowledge of optimal C/C++ coding techniques that the rest of us can > keep in mind while we work.
Check my C/C++ blog: thewayofc.blogspot.com (I have three blogs, which I'm still not sure was a good idea). I frequently measure and tweak code and always do measurements to see how well it fares. Some of those end up there, if I feel inclined to write the surrounding text. You will see some of the measurements resulting from this project there as well. /Matz > > :) > > -jay > > Andy Lester wrote: >> On Aug 4, 2008, at 9:28 AM, Jay Pipes wrote: >> >>> 100 * .001 = .1 >>> >>> Your point is good, though. :) >> >> All of this is irrelevant, though. We're violating the 2nd rule of >> Optimization Club: >> >> 1. The first rule of Optimization Club is, you do not Optimize. >> 2. The second rule of Optimization Club is, you do not Optimize >> without measuring. >> 3. If your app is running faster than the underlying transport >> protocol, the optimization is over. >> 4. One factor at a time. >> 5. No marketroids, no marketroid schedules. >> 6. Testing will go on as long as it has to. >> 7. If this is your first night at Optimization Club, you have to >> write a test case. >> >> -- >> Andy Lester => [EMAIL PROTECTED] => www.petdance.com => AIM:petdance >> >> >> >> > > _______________________________________________ > Mailing list: https://launchpad.net/~drizzle-discuss > Post to : [email protected] > Unsubscribe : https://launchpad.net/~drizzle-discuss > More help : https://help.launchpad.net/ListHelp -- Mats Kindahl Lead Software Developer Replication Team MySQL AB, www.mysql.com
begin:vcard fn:Mats Kindahl n:Kindahl;Mats org:Sun Microsystems adr;quoted-printable:;;Tegv=C3=A4gen 3;Storvreta;SE;74334;Sweden email;internet:[EMAIL PROTECTED] title:Lead Replication Software Developer x-mozilla-html:FALSE version:2.1 end:vcard
_______________________________________________ Mailing list: https://launchpad.net/~drizzle-discuss Post to : [email protected] Unsubscribe : https://launchpad.net/~drizzle-discuss More help : https://help.launchpad.net/ListHelp

